1. The Longevity Boom & Modern Biohacking

Preventive healthcare has moved from specialized clinical settings directly into mainstream American households. Americans are no longer waiting for illness to hit before taking action; instead, they are investing heavily in longevity and daily physical optimization.

Home-Based Recovery Tools
Professional spa treatments and physical therapy sessions are being replaced by accessible home recovery systems:

* Infrared Sauna Blankets: Compact, portable sauna blankets have become a staple for muscle recovery, stress relief, and improved circulation.

* Cold Plunge & Contrast Therapy: Home cold-water therapy units are being installed in suburban backyards across the US as daily mood-boosting and anti-inflammatory habits.

*Red Light Therapy Panels: Small wall-mounted or tabletop LED red-light panels are widely used for skin regeneration, collagen boost, and circadian rhythm alignment.

Preventive Biomarker Tracking

Rather than relying solely on annual doctor visits, US consumers are opting for continuous, self-monitored health metrics. Continuous Glucose Monitors (CGMs), heart rate variability (HRV) trackers, and metabolic health apps are helping people map out exact diet adjustments tailored to their bodies.

2. Advanced Sleep Hygiene Protocols

Sleep is officially treated as the foundation of health in North America. Sleep optimization is no longer just about buying a comfortable mattress; it has developed into a precise nightly routine supported by functional wellness products.

Nasal Breathing & Mouth Taping
Mouth taping during sleep has gained immense popularity across social channels and wellness blogs. By encouraging nasal breathing during rest, individuals report reduced snoring, lower incidence of morning dry mouth, and deeper REM sleep cycles.

Ergonomic & Sleep-Conscious Accessories
Everyday fashion and accessories are adapting to sleep comfort. For example, flat-back earrings and specialized soft-grip hair ties designed specifically to prevent irritation during sleep have seen exponential sales growth on US e-commerce platforms.

3. The High-Fiber & Gut Health Revolution

While protein-centric diets dominated American nutrition over the past decade, the focus in 2026 has expanded to gut microbiome support and natural digestion through fiber-dense eating.

"Fiber-Maxxing" in Daily Meals 
Nutritionists and content creators in the US are actively advocating for "fiber-maxxing." Meals are crafted around high-soluble-fiber ingredients such as chia seeds, legumes, psyllium husk, avocados, and cruciferous vegetables to support blood sugar stability and digestive wellness.

Functional Beverages Take Over Cans
Traditional high-sugar sodas continue to lose shelf space in major US supermarkets like Whole Foods and Target. In their place, functional prebiotic drinks, botanical sparkling waters, and adaptogenic teas designed to lower cortisol levels are dominating retail beverage aisles.

4. Micro-Workouts and Low-Impact Fitness

The era of extreme, high-exhaustion daily workouts is taking a back seat. Americans are adopting low-impact, sustainable movement habits that fit effortlessly into remote and hybrid work routines.

Rucking & Walking Pad Culture
Rucking—walking with a weighted backpack—has become a preferred cardio routine for outdoor enthusiasts. For indoor remote workers, under-desk walking pads paired with standing desks have become standard equipment to maintain a consistent step count throughout the workday.

Pilates and Mobility Focus
Functional mobility, core strength, and joint health are prioritized over pure muscle hypertrophy. Reformer Pilates, soft yoga flows, and daily mobility stretching routines are driving massive participation across suburban fitness studios.

5. Sustainable Home Living & Zero-Waste Shifts

Environmental awareness in the US has moved beyond abstract eco-talk into concrete daily household decisions. American households are actively replacing short-life disposable items with durable, reusable alternatives.

Phasing Out Single-Use Plastics
US consumers are increasingly choosing non-toxic materials for everyday items:

* Glass & Stainless Steel: Glass straws, borosilicate water bottles, and stainless steel lunch boxes have replaced single-use plastics.

* Refillable Personal Care: Deodorants, hand soaps, and cleaning solutions offered in concentrated refills or aluminum containers are capturing major retail market share.

* Non-Toxic Cookware: Ceramic and cast-iron cookware sales have surged as consumers phase out legacy non-stick pans containing PFAS chemicals.

6. Digital Detox & "Slow Living" Movement

As daily digital saturation reaches an all-time high, a counter-movement focused on offline hobbies, real-world community, and screen-free personal time has emerged strongly across America.

Analog Hobbies & Paper Culture
Younger demographics across US metropolitan areas are rediscovering analog activities. Book clubs, board game cafes, backyard gardening, physical paper journals, and film photography are experiencing a massive revival as people look for authentic offline experiences.

Minimalist Communication Devices
"Dumbphones" or secondary minimalist devices that handle only basic calling and text messaging are being purchased by individuals seeking to disconnect over weekends and holidays without being entirely unreachable in emergencies.
